Using ngchange with fileupload input type file in angularjs. By clicking on this button, a screen you get to see a. Angularjs application showcasing custom directives, services, ajax, filters, dynamic tables with automatically updated totals as stock quotes are retrieved and displayed. The expression is evaluated immediately, unlike the javascript onchange event which only triggers at the end of a change usually, when the user leaves the form element or presses the return key.
Nov 05, 2015 event handling in angularjs angularjs ng click example angularjs ng click event in this video we will discuss how to handle events in angularjs. Angularjs is meant to replace jquery, which is a simple but popular. These components are directives, services, filters, providers, templates, global apis, and testing mocks there is also a guide with articles on various topics, and a list of. Here mudassar ahmed khan has explained with an example, how to use ng change directive with fileupload element input type file in angularjs. With the help of ng change directive we calling a funtion on change of the textbox value, we change the visibility of the container in this function.
It extends html attributes with directives and binds data to html with expressions. For illustration purposes this article will explain how to show hide toggle html div on checkbox click i. Material design is a specification for a unified system of visual, motion, and interaction design that adapts across different devices. The image will be stored in a folder directory on the server and will be displayed by assign the url of the image to the ngsrc directive in. This is a simple implementation of d3js in an angular app. For this tutorial, well create a simple form that has a file upload field, which binds with a controller to get the data from the form. Angularjs also does not intercept and rewrite links in this mode. In angularjs, routing is what allows you to create single page applications. This tutorial is specially designed to help you learn angularjs as quickly and efficiently as possible. An intermediate development guide covering all major features of angular. On choosing the file it have to change to dynamicname.
In this section you will learn to download and install angularjs library. How to change filename in a file input with angularjs. The input still has to reflect any other changes to the model if the model will be updated in other place, value of the input should reflect this change. Follow these steps to make your own copy of the hello world app. If you click the save button, your code will be saved, and you get an url you can share with others. Pdf document display and file downloads with angular. Here in this tutorial we are going to explain some of them. Our goal is to deliver a lean, lightweight set of angularjs native ui elements that implement the material design specification for use in angularjs singlepage applications sp. Then you will learn everything else you need to know about angularjs. Declarative templates with databinding, mvw, mvvm, mvc, dependency injection and great testability story all implemented with pure clientside javascript. May 18, 2016 hi guys, in the previous post we have learned how to create a grid with paging,sorting,filtering in this post ill show you how to upload a file in angularjs. In this article i am using the example of changing the website background color dynamically at the runtime.
Angularjs extends html with ngdirectives the ngapp directive defines an angularjs application the ngmodel directive binds the value of html controls input, select, textarea to application data the ngbind directive binds application data to the html view. The image will be stored in a folder directory on the server and will be displayed by assign the url of the. Angularjs simple file download causes router to redirect. This article will illustrate how to use javascript onchange event handler to call a function inside angularjs.
Our goal is to deliver a lean, lightweight set of angularjs native ui elements that implement the material design specification for use in angularjs singlepage applications spas. Angularjs is what html would have been, had it been designed for building webapps. Angularjs uses its scopes as a glue between the model and view and makes these updates in one available for the other. Angular is a platform for building mobile and desktop web applications. Declarative templates with databinding, mvc, dependency injection and great testability story all implemented with pure clientside javascript. This article will illustrate how to use javascript onchange event handler to call a function inside angularjs controller. The ngchange directive the angularjs ngchange directive, which is used with the input fields like textboxes, textarea, select etc, evaluates the given expression as the value is changed by the user. We will be showing random titles which we have already set in an array to the user whenever. If youre still using the angularjs server you should switch to the cdn version for even faster loading times. Angularjs directives allow you to specify custom and reusable html tags that moderate the behavior of certain elements.
Here mudassar ahmed khan has explained with an example, how to dynamically change src of image element in angularjs. To perform change event operations in angularjs, we use ng change directive. In this article i will explain with an example, how to use angularjs ng change directive with checkboxes. The ng directive should be used instead of if you have angularjs code inside the value. A sample web application and discussions on creating, displaying, and downloading pdf documents with web api data sources including asp. The ng directive makes sure the link is not broken even if the user clicks the link before angularjs has evaluated the code.
The ng change directive tells angularjs what to do when the value of an html element changes. Databinding is an automatic way of updating the view whenever the model changes, as well as updating the model. Download a zip file in angularjs hot network questions what will be the major product of the reaction between 2r,3r2,3dimethyloxirane and triphenylphosphine. An ngmodel directive is required by the ng change directive. Developers can download the sample application as an eclipse project in the downloads section. Angularjs change button text example web code geeks 2020. You can put this in a function and call it with ngclick if you need to trigger the download from a button. This can be found within sublime text at preferences browse packages.
These pages contain the angularjs reference materials for version the documentation is organized into modules which contain various components of an angularjs application. Click on that you will see a dialog box like below. In this example we have a textbox to hide and show the container with text. Install with bower install with npm view source on github doc humanizedoc directivebrackets. What i need is to have ngmodel directive to work just like it worked in the older versions of angularjs. Angularjs routes allow one to show multiple contents depending on which route is chosen. Mar 11, 2019 here mudassar ahmed khan has explained with an example, how to dynamically change src of image element in angularjs. On the iam console, we need to create a user for the serverless framework. In this article, we are going to see how we can change the title of a page dynamically using angularjs. The ngchange expression is only evaluated when a change in the input value causes a new value to be committed to the model. Change detection is the mechanism responsible for data binding in angular.
There are two types of angularjs script urls you can point to, one for development and one for production. Dec 06, 2014 directives are a very powerful concept in angular. Stepbystep we have provided localization for our yeoman angularjs app. Thanks to it you dont need to manually manipulate the dom tree. In below block, we have declared 3 functions each for change event of checkbox, textbox and dropdown respectively.
You can use our online editor to edit and try the code. Deploying an angularjs app to aws in seconds or 10 minutes. These components are directives, services, filters, providers, templates, global apis, and testing mocks there is also a guide with articles on. How to assign src to images dynamically in angularjs. Lets build a uirouter for angularjs hello world application. In angularjs there is one directive ngstyle that can change cascade style sheet css dynamically as you want at runtime. Ng change is a directive in angularjs which is meant for performing operations when a component value or event is changed. We understand how to create translations files, handling translations in htmltemplates, and angularjs controllers. The ng change directive from angularjs will not override the elements original onchange event, both the ng change expression and the original onchange event will be executed. The ng change directive requires a ngmodel directive to be present.
Angularjs ng change like functionality for the entire form. Click on that you will see a dialog box like below to choose a minified version, select 1. Angularjs change button color onclick ngclick example. Apr, 2020 data and data models in angularjs are plain javascript objects and one can add and change properties directly on it and loop over objects and arrays at will. A short beginner guide explaining the basic concepts of angular. Net core, client angular cli or angularjs components, and resolutions for. Navigate between the hello and about links and watch the ui change. Its not meant to be a finished product, but just an example of how you might integrate the two. Apr 08, 2019 in this article, we are going to learn how to deploy our angularjs web app to aws s3 as quick as possible. Reactive, responsive, beautiful charts for angularjs based on chart. As mentioned earlier download and install angularjs is a javascript library which is used in a web application.
To work with the angularjs we need to download and install angularjs library into the project. I know this is an old post but i had trouble getting any solution on stack exchange working for an automatic download with an angular post. Angularjs environment setup this chapter describes how to set up angularjs library to be used in web application development. This way, you dont have to download anything or maintain a local copy. When given a form we would like to call a method for every change in one of the forms fields. The ng directive overrides the original attribute of an element. Angularjs is a javascript framework added to a html page with a tag. Mar 16, 2015 you can see that by switching the language on the about page it will, then, change the page layout. To perform change event operations in angularjs, we use ng change directive in below block, we have declared 3 functions each for change event of checkbox, textbox and dropdown respectively. The ng directive overrides the original attribute of an element the ng directive should be used instead of if you have angularjs code inside the value the ng directive makes sure the link is not broken even if the user clicks the link before angularjs has evaluated the code. It also briefly describes the directory structure and its cont. Angularjs download html table template file as excel. There are many ways to change button color in angularjs. Change page titles dynamically using angularjs dzone web dev.
How can i download zip file using angularjs stack overflow. By using ngtable module in angularjs applications we can achieve functionalities like showing data in a table format, sorting. Hi guys, in the previous post we have learned how to create a grid with paging,sorting,filtering in this post ill show you how to upload a file in angularjs. Angularjs download html table template file as excel using. Angularjs routes enable you to create different urls for different content in your application. Download this repo, rename it to angularjs, and place it within your packages folder. My current approach is to make an invisible iframe and load that url in it so as to get the save as popup for the downloaded file. The final directive should be used like this internally we want the directive. Change the html title and head elements on a perview basis. In other words, ng change directive tells angularjs what to do when the value of an html element changes. But i need to change the name of the file before the save as popup.
An advanced reference of all angular classes, methods, etc. Lets say we want to create a directive to display user profiles. Change background color dynamically using angularjs. I ran into this issue and reading through the comments, while the way it currently works due to the isolate scope makes sense. I need to download a file from an ajax get request in angularjs the ajax query redirects to the download link.
In this article, we are going to learn how to deploy our angularjs web app to aws s3 as quick as possible. Update the server for each change in one of our fields. This article will illustrate how to dynamically change the src attribute of image element using the ngsrc directive in angularjs. Angularjs ngchange like functionality for the entire form. There is no binding support for fileupload element input type file in angularjs and hence ng change directive cannot be used. Feb 15, 2020 module to be able to change the locale at an angularjs application lgalfasoangulardynamiclocale. Extensive documentation and examples are included with the angularjs download package. In normal use, angularjss router allows the selected view to affect a. How do you serve a file for download with angularjs or javascript. This article describes how to change the website background dynamically using angularjs.